NeighbourhoodThis apartment on Badhuisweg sits right on the water in the Oude Haven area of Zaandam. Built in 1994, it has 80 m² of living space and an energy label G, which means heating costs will be significant. The asking price of €430,000 is on the high side compared to other apartments in Zaanstad.
Het Eiland is a small, tight-knit neighbourhood with a mix of families and older residents. The area has a very high density of addresses, giving it an urban feel. There are no resident reviews available for this neighbourhood.
For daily shopping, you have Dekamarkt just around the corner, Vomar a couple of streets away, and Albert Heijn a five-minute walk. The nearest primary school, OBS Herman Gorter, is also just around the corner. The municipality Zaanstad offers a range of amenities within easy reach.

About Badhuisweg 150, Zaandam
The asking price of €430,000 is on the high side compared to other apartments in Zaanstad. However, the exact market value depends on factors like condition and location. The energy label G means higher energy costs, which may affect the overall value.
Energy label G is the lowest rating, indicating poor energy efficiency. You can expect high heating and electricity bills.
The nearest train station is 1.7 km away, which is about a 20-minute walk or a short cycle ride.
The closest primary school is OBS Herman Gorter, just 455 metres away. Other nearby options include ICBS het Zaanplein (856 m) and Openbare Basisschool De Voorzaan (882 m).
Yes, a park or public garden is just 0.1 km away, so it's on your doorstep.
In the most recent data, there were 19 total crimes reported in Het Eiland. This is relatively low, but it's always a good idea to check local crime statistics for the most current picture.
